Well that depends on several things...Is it a Red Eagle on the grip or is it a Black Eagle ? 4-3/4" or 6' Barrel with fixed sights OR Is it a heavy Barreled Target 5-1/2 " or 5-1/4" Tapered , or 6-7/8" heavy Tapered barrel with adjustable rear sights ?
Also, what condition is it in as far as wear and blueing , Etc. ???

Measure the Barrel , Take pics , Look at the symbols , and the rear sights...
All this can help determine if it is a 300 dollar gun or an 800 dollar gun...
Condition is crucial as well and if it has the Original Box...

Methinks Mooseman184 is just using price numbers illustrating that from low to high you could be talking about a 2 or 3 to 1 difference depending on factors mentioned in the posts. I recently purchased a clean as a whistle non-blemished 1966 A54 MKI w/2 mags and a holster (no box or instructions) for $180 out the door. From threads I have seen, excluding the more collectible red emblem on the grip, anything from $150-250 depending on condition is reasonable.
